Production Method

The production process of hospital laundry involves several stages, including sorting, washing, drying, ironing, and packaging. The following is a vertically numbered bullet point flowchart outlining the production process:

  • 1. Sorting: Separate soiled linens into different categories based on fabric type, color, and degree of soiling.
  • 2. Pre-treatment: Remove any visible stains or debris from the linens using specialized equipment.
  • 3. Washing: Wash the linens in large industrial washing machines using a combination of hot water and detergent.
  • 4. Drying: Dry the washed linens using industrial dryers or steam tunnels.
  • 5. Ironing: Iron the dried linens using industrial ironing machines to remove any wrinkles or creases.
  • 6. Packaging: Package the cleaned and ironed linens in bags or containers for distribution to healthcare facilities.

Business Sectors

Hospital laundry operations can be categorized into the following business sectors:

  • On-site laundry: Laundry operations located within the hospital premises.
  • Off-site laundry: Laundry operations located outside the hospital premises, but still serving the hospital.
  • Contract laundry: Laundry operations that provide services to multiple hospitals or healthcare facilities.

Feasibility Study

A feasibility study is essential to determine the viability of a hospital laundry project. The study should assess the following factors:

  • Market demand: Evaluate the demand for hospital laundry services in the area.
  • Competition: Assess the competition in the market and identify opportunities for differentiation.
  • Financial projections: Estimate the startup costs, operating expenses, and revenue projections.
  • Regulatory compliance: Ensure compliance with relevant regulations and standards.
